Being shot by a paintball gun doesn’t sound incredibly entertaining. So why is paintball on the list of quickest increasing athletics in America, based on the Nationwide Sporting Goods Association? “It’s a anxiety aid, as you can head out and shoot at people and never dangerously hit them,” Vasaris claimed. “But it’s also currently being with a gaggle of guys that you like to hang around with.”
The most commonly performed paintball video game is “seize the flag.” You will find principles variants, but the item is for just a workforce to seize the opposing crew’s flag when safeguarding its own. Players get rid of opponents by shooting them with their paintball guns.
The video games may be performed exterior in an open up area or forest, or within at a specifically designed facility with inflatable bunkers and also other road blocks. “It’s not the conceal-and-find sport Every person thinks,” Vasaris claimed. “It’s actually motion-packed and fast-paced.” Gamers use carbon dioxide- or nitrogen-driven guns that fireplace slender, gelatin capsules crammed with non-harmful paint – the “paintballs.”
